Your Workspace ONE UEM deployment has several essential, or core, services that enable your deployment to run successfully. These services include the console, device services, API, and AWCM. To help you diagnose problems, VMware provides logging data if you have issues with any of these core services.
The core services of Workspace ONE UEM are its foundation, the pieces required for your deployment to run properly and efficiently. If the service you need assistance with does not display here, view the Integrated Component Logging section for an extensive list of integrated services and their log information.
There are two logging levels that provide different levels of detail. To reduce the use of hardware resources, set the logging level to disabled if you are not troubleshooting a service.
In the console with a system administrator level account at the global organization group, navigate to Groups & Settings > All Settings > Admin > Diagnostics > Logging.
Select a service that needs an increased logging level. Set the service logging to Enabled.
After you finish troubleshooting, revert the logging level to Disabled to preserve hardware resources.
For assistance with SaaS environments, contact VMware Support as these configurations are only accessible in on-premises environments.
How to Read a Workspace ONE UEM Log Entry
The ability to read a Workspace ONE UEM log entry is key to successfully analyzing and troubleshooting any issues you might encounter with your Workspace ONE UEM deployment.
Every log entry contains the following key information.
Date and time
Server identifier
Server communication thread identifier
Device or user identifier
Workspace ONE UEM thread identifier
Logging level
Associated service
Log message
Error Log Example
Workspace ONE UEM error logs use the following format:
2017/06/21 19:07:12.243[1] EX-DS111[2] 11aaabbccc-dddee-1111-22ff-06gggg777777[3] [0000000-0000000][4] (14)[5] Error[6] AirWatch.CloudConnector.Client.AccServiceClient.SendRequest[7] Received a Failure message from AWCM: Destination not reachable at this moment[8]
Information Log Example
Workspace ONE UEM Information logs use the following format:
2017/09/07 14:46:57.852[1] EX-DS111[2] ca9562a7-c87c-4c3b-a1e1-ca35a88555ab[3] [0000052-0000000][4] (20)[5] Info[6] WanderingWiFi.AirWatch.Console.Web.Controllers.HomeController[7] Method: WanderingWiFi.AirWatch.Console.Web.Controllers.HomeController.Index; LocationGroupID: 7; UserID: 52; UserName: TEST_USER; Parameters: <N/A>; 69eddd96-9a81-47e9-a78a-dd20c845426b
Console Logging
Folder |
Log Name |
Description |
---|---|---|
AirWatch API |
AW_Core_Api.log |
Contains information on calls made to the API endpoint for available API commands. |
AirWatch API |
AW_MAM_Api.log |
Contains information relating to specifically the /API/MAM endpoint. |
AirWatch API |
AW_MCM_Api.log |
Contains information relating to specifically the /API/MCM endpoint. |
AirWatch API |
AW_MDM_Api.log |
Contains information relating to specifically the /API/MDM endpoint. |
AirWatch API |
AW_MEM_Api.log |
Contains information relating to specifically the /API/MEM endpoint. |
AirWatch Services |
AWServices.log |
Contains information on the AirWatch SOAP API. |
DesiredStateManagement |
DSM.log |
Contains information about Windows 10 Device State Management. |
IIS>W3SVC1 |
u_ex####.log |
Contains the history of IIS web endpoints accessed and response codes delivered (Example: /AirWatch & /Enroll). |
C:/ > Inetpub > Logs > FailedReqLogFiles |
Fr####.xml |
Contains failed IIS request log traces. The log is disabled by default. You must enable it. |
Services |
AirWatchGemAgent.log |
Contains information on the GEM License assessing service and its back-end connections. |
Services |
ApiWorkflowService.log |
This service log cites processed device commands from the REST API. |
Services |
AW.Meg.Queue.Service.log |
Contains information on the email policy updates for SEG or Powershell integration, associated MSMQ reader information, SQL connection errors, and encryption ciphers. |
Services |
AW.IntegrationService.log |
Contains information on all AW third-party integrations such as Apple School Manager APIs, VPP, and App Scan. |
Services |
BackgroundProcessorServiceLogFile.txt |
Contains information on multiple different jobs that are processed in the background asynchronously such as console exports or report generation. |
Services |
BulkProcessingServiceLogFile.txt |
Contains information on bulk commands such as SDK, certificates, APNS messages, DEP APIs, command queues, users, user groups, profiles, and apps. |
Services |
ChangeEventOutboundQueueService.log |
Sends event notifications from source component to a central location (Example: Syslog). |
Services |
ChangeEventQueue.log |
Contains information on event log entries, the batch save of those logs, syslog configuration loads, and policy updates for AW Tunnel. |
Services |
ComplianceService.log |
Contains information about device compliance status and actions executed as part of compliance policies. |
Services |
ContentDeliveryService.log |
Contains information on content delivery and relay server communication for product provisioning. |
Services |
DirectorySyncServiceLogFile.txt |
Contains information on directory user and group syncs such as member lists and LDAP mapping and definitions. |
Services |
EntityReconcileService.log |
Contains information on reconcile and sync for entities linked to smart groups. |
Services |
MessagingServiceLog.txt |
Contains information on notifications sent to the various 3rd party messaging services (APNs, GCM, WNS). |
Services |
PolicyEngine.log |
Contains information on the device policies queue and products information related to user, OG and device compliance. It will also include information on product provisioning processing and delivery. |
Services |
PurgeUtility.log |
Contains information on purge tasks and job run status. |
Services |
SchedulerService.log |
Contains information on the various jobs that are executed by the scheduler service such as Automatic sync, VPP user invite sync, bulk notification push, and AD sync triggers. For an exhaustive list, see Groups & Settings > All Settings > Admin > Scheduler. |
Services |
SmartGroupServiceLogFile.txt |
Contains information relating to reconciliation of smart group mappings resulting from enrollments, changes in device or user state, and reports the resulting change for smart groups. |
Services |
SMSService.log |
Contains information on batch SMS sent to devices. |
Services |
Ws1.Tunnel.Kestrel.log |
Tunnel services logs related to .net core based microservices. |
Tools |
DeviceStateMigrationTool.log |
Contains information on legacy android device migration. |
Tools |
EntitlementServiceMigrationTool.log |
Contains information on legacy android device migration. |
Web console |
WebLogFile.txt |
Contains information on the console user interface. |
TargetedLogging |
####Airwatch.log TargetedLogging_<servicename>.log |
Contains information on targeted logging enabled devices or services. |
Device Services and Self-Service Portal Logging
Folder |
Log Name |
Description |
---|---|---|
AirWatch API |
AW_Core_Api.log |
Contains information on calls made to the API endpoint for available API commands. |
AirWatch API |
AW_MAM_Api.log |
Contains information relating to specifically the /API/MAM endpoint. |
AirWatch API |
AW_MCM_Api.log |
Contains information relating to specifically the /API/MCM endpoint. |
AirWatch API |
AW_MDM_Api.log |
Contains information relating to specifically the /API/MDM endpoint. |
AirWatch API |
AW_MEM_Api.log |
Contains information relating to specifically the /API/MEM endpoint. |
AirWatch API |
ws1.gateway.log |
WS1-Services logs. |
AirWatch Services |
AWServices.log |
Contains information on the AirWatch services including logging level and service details. This log also contains SOAP API related information. |
AppCatalog |
AppCatalogLogFile.txt |
Contains information related to the application catalog such as application assignment, device requests when loading the app catalog, and user authentication. |
DesiredStateManagement |
DSM.log |
Contains information about Windows 10 Device State Management. |
DeviceManagement |
DeviceManagement.log |
Contains information on the early stages of enrollment including token or group ID validation, restriction checks, and authentication. |
DeviceServices |
DeviceServicesLog.txt |
Contains information related to all device communications with Workspace ONE UEM. |
DeviceService |
DevicesGateway.log |
Logging for the subset of APIs dedicated to devices. |
Enroll Shortcut |
EnrollShortcut.log |
Information on URL redirects such as /enroll. |
EntitlementService |
VMware.UEM.EntitlementService.Log |
Contains information on the provided APIs to create entitlement rules. |
IdentityService |
IdentityService.log |
Information about the SAML web endpoint. |
IIS>W3SVC1 |
u_ex####.log |
Contains history of IIS web endpoints accessed and response codes delivered (Example: /DeviceServices & /DeviceManagement). |
C:/ > Inetpub > Logs > FailedReqLogFiles |
Fr####.xml |
Contains failed IIS request log traces. This log must be enabled as it is turned off by default. |
MetadataTransformService |
Metadatatransfromservice.log |
Contains information on the stored metadata used to render the data driven user interface. |
MyDevice |
WebLogfile.txt |
Contains information on actions taken within the self-service portal. |
Services |
ws1tunnel.kestrel |
All the DB queries from Microservice. Log level is OFF by default. |
Services |
ws1.tunnel.log |
Tunnel Microservice application/functional logs. These logs also contain the equivalent of IIS logs about API status, time taken, etc. |
Services |
APIWorkflowService.log |
Contains information on the API such as logging level, MSMQ reader errors, and SQL connection errors. |
Services |
AW.IntegrationService.log |
Contains information on all AW third-party integrations such as Apple School Manager APIs, VPP, and App Scan. |
Services |
AW.Meg.Queue.Service.log |
Contains information on the email policy updates for SEG or Powershell integration, associated MSMQ reader information, SQL connection errors, and encryption ciphers. |
Services |
BulkProcessingServiceLogFile.txt |
Contains information on bulk commands related to SDK, certificates, APNS messages, DEP APIs, command queues, users, user groups, profiles, and apps. |
Services |
ChangeEventQueue.log |
Contains information on event log entries, the batch save of those logs, syslog configuration loads, and policy updates for AW Tunnel. |
Services |
EntityReconcileService.log |
Contains information on reconcile and sync for entities linked to smart groups. |
Services |
InterrogatorQueueService.log |
Contains information related to processed device samples for all platforms to be updated to the DB such as Application and Profile samples from device. |
Services |
MessagingServiceLog.txt |
Contains information on sends and response times to the various third-party messaging services (APNs, GCM, WNS). |
Services |
ProvisioningPackageServicelogfile.txt |
Logs provisioning package information for auto enrollment of applicable Windows 10 device. |
Services |
ChangeEventOutboundQueueService.txt |
Sends event notifications from source component to a central location (Example: Syslog). |
Services |
SmartGroupServiceLogfile.log |
Information relating to reconciliation of smart group mappings resulting from enrollments or changes in device or user state, and the resulting change for smart groups. |
TargetedLogging |
####Airwatch.log TargetedLogging_<servicename>.log |
Contains information on targeted logging enabled devices or services. |
Trust Service |
TrustService.log |
Logging associated with an on-premises instance of the Trust Service that is used for Certificate Pinning. |
API Logging
Folder |
Log Name |
Description |
---|---|---|
AirWatch API |
AW_Core_Api.log |
Contains information on calls made to the API endpoint for available API commands. |
AirWatch API |
AW_MAM_Api.log |
Contains information relating to specifically the /API/MAM endpoint. |
AirWatch API |
AW_MCM_Api.log |
Contains information relating to specifically the /API/MCM endpoint. |
AirWatch API |
AW_MDM_Api.log |
Contains information relating to specifically the /API/MDM endpoint. |
AirWatch API |
AW_MEM_Api.log |
Contains information relating to specifically the /API/MEM endpoint. |
AirWatch API |
CiscoiseLogfile.txt |
Information about CiscoISE integration. |
AirWatch API |
ws1.gateway.log |
Information about devicesgateway API. |
AirWatch Services |
AWServices.log |
Contains information on the Workspace ONE UEM services including logging level and service details. This log also contains SOAP API-related information. |
IIS>W3SVC1 |
u_ex####.log |
Contains history of IIS web endpoints accessed and response codes delivered (Example: /ActiveSyncIntegrationServiceEndPoint). |
C:/ > Inetpub > Logs > FailedReqLogFiles |
Fr####.xml |
Contains failed IIS request log traces. This log must be enabled as it is turned off by default. |
Services |
APIWorkflowService.log |
Contains information on handing bulk requests from the API server such as bulk commands to devices. |
Services |
AW.IntegrationService.log |
Contains information on all AW third-party integrations such as Apple School Manager APIs, VPP, and App Scan. |
Services |
AW.Meg.Queue.Service.log |
Contains information on the email policy updates for SEG or Powershell integration, associated MSMQ reader information, SQL connection errors, and encryption ciphers. |
Services |
BulkProcessingServiceLogFile.txt |
Contains information on bulk commands related to SDK, certificates, APNS messages, DEP APIs, command queues, users, user groups, profiles, and apps. |
Services |
ChangeEventQueue.log |
Contains information on event log entries, the batch save of those logs, and syslog configuration loads. |
Services |
EntityReconcileService.log |
Contains information on reconcile and sync for entities linked to smart groups. |
Services |
MessagingServiceLog.txt |
Contains information on sends and response times to the various third-party messaging services (APNs, GCM, WNS). |
Services |
ChangeEventOutboundQueueService.txt |
Log file for entering information into the MSMQ to be sent to central outbound component (Example: Syslog). |
Services |
SmartGroupServiceLogfile.log |
Information relating to reconciliation of smart group mappings resulting from enrollments or changes in device or user state, and the resulting change for smart groups. |
Services |
DataPlatformService.log |
Information about sending Windows 10 samples (requires Workspace ONE Intelligence). |
AWCM Logging
Folder |
Log Name |
Description |
---|---|---|
AWCM |
Awcm.log |
Contains information on AWCM such as status, history, properties, and additional sub-services. |
AWCM |
AWCMservice.log |
Contains log information on AWCM Java service wrapper. |